Output 1968fef2de3c0b41b1d9d2f7bc2d1fdcde4b39c16d33ae0c3f58594a6a88f726:32

value
6195
script pubkey
OP_HASH160 OP_PUSHBYTES_20 431f91b878a63a668a0b2ce334b900a02f74d7af OP_EQUAL
address
37ow1s5qs73rJPouEziMsK8NxewJHkdQ9d
transaction
1968fef2de3c0b41b1d9d2f7bc2d1fdcde4b39c16d33ae0c3f58594a6a88f726
confirmations
572815
spent
true